This f**king problem hunting me several years...

In gvim, the underscore '_' not shown...

dejavu 10.5

my fontconfig:

<?xml version="1.0"?>
<!DOCTYPE fontconfig SYSTEM "fonts.dtd">
<!-- /etc/fonts/fonts.conf file to configure system font access -->
<fontconfig>

<alias>
<family>serif</family>
<prefer>
<family>DejaVu Serif</family>
<family>WenQuanYi Micro Hei</family>
</prefer>
</alias>
<alias>
<family>sans-serif</family>
<prefer>
<family>DejaVu Sans</family>
<family>WenQuanYi Micro Hei</family>
</prefer>
</alias>
<alias>
<family>monospace</family>
<prefer>
<family>DejaVu Sans Mono</family>
<family>WenQuanYi Micro Hei Mono</family>
</prefer>
</alias>
<!--Global fonts rendering settings-->
<match target="font">
<edit name="hinting">
<bool>true</bool>
<!--<bool>false</bool>-->
</edit>
<edit name="autohint">
<bool>false</bool>
<!--<bool>true</bool>-->
</edit>
<edit name="antialias">
<bool>true</bool>
</edit>
<edit name="hintstyle">
<const>hintslight</const>
<!--<const>hintfull</const>-->
</edit>
<edit name="embeddedbitmap">
<bool>false</bool>
</edit>
<edit name="rgba" mode="assign">
<const>rgb</const>
</edit>
</match>

<!--Global settings for Display Size/DPI-->
<match target="pattern">
<edit name="dpi" mode="assign" >
<double>96</double>
</edit>
</match>


</fontconfig>


➜ ruby-china git:(master) ✗ cat ~/.Xresources
Xft.dpi: 96
Xft.rgba: rgb
Xft.hinting: true
Xft.antialias: true
Xft.hintstyle: hintslight

Did you try running with the default gvim (no plugins, color schemes, etc), but with only the font changed to what you are using? If it works fine there, then you can start introducing the extensions and plugins one by one and see if you see one which breaks your font.
